After doling out huge contracts in the off-season, a 2-6 record at the midpoint isn’t exactly what the Oakland Raiders expected.
A 41-14 blow-out at home in the opener, the Lane Kiffin firing and the recent news regarding veterans that may be on the way out has highlighted a first half that has Raider fans losing [...]
If the Raiders had anything definitive on the condition of quarterback JaMarcus Russell and his right knee, they were wisely keeping it to themselves.
Russell was listed as questionable to start Sunday’s game against the Carolina Panthers, and the tendonitis in his right knee was significant enough for him to miss Friday’s practice after sitting out [...]
